Output 52589487fbd93626c0f4828276a346d297b5e9d7758be5ad566e7da99486a77e:0

value
31994995564
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57a166ae731d4ec759754f83e0c3473e10a8dc20 OP_EQUALVERIFY OP_CHECKSIG
address
18zM92zAErXX1sLYWnkMBhGyhLabs8UJbi
transaction
52589487fbd93626c0f4828276a346d297b5e9d7758be5ad566e7da99486a77e
spent
true